Frequently asked questions

Are pets allowed at The Hides?

Yes, dogs are welcome. There's a charge of GBP 5 per pet, per day. Service animals are exempt from fees. Food and water bowls are available.

Is parking offered on site at The Hides?

No, unfortunately, but there's free parking nearby.

What are the check-in and check-out times at The Hides?

Check-in start time: 4:00 PM; Check-in end time: anytime. Check-out time is 10:30 AM.

Does The Hides have any outdoor private spaces?

Yes, every room features a patio.

What's the area around The Hides like?

The Hides is a short 7-minute walk from Northumberland Coast and 17 minutes' walk from Seahouses Golf Club.

8/10 Very good

Room basic, clean. Found it cold in the evening although heating in room. door didn’t shut very well so there was a slight gap, this may of been the problem. As a cheap base for outdoors people it would be ideal. Friendly staff who greeted us. Location ideal for village where there are takeaways and restaurants. Short walk.

2/10 Poor

The room was small, with very little space for luggage. I was staying alone. It had been recently decorated; I picked up on the feint smell of drying paint and some new decor. Had there been four, or eight people staying (as advertised), it would have been extremely uncomfortable for all. The bunk beds were mid-way between single and double; quite close together. The noise coming from fluid in pipes along with a constant low-frequency tone/drone would have made it impossible to sleep. Do they have an air pump? I complained by VM quieter after I’d been out; no response to my VM. I watched the TV sat on the bed as from as the table/chair directly under the TV would have been uncomfortable. The bed sunk considerably when any weight was put on it. The room was cold. My phone displayed 9C. Radiator was stone cold. I was going to get a shower but realised, no towels. I was going to have a cup of tea but all of the tea making facilities were in the kitchen down the way, except oddly a kettle had been left in the room? Went to bed at 11PM; woke up sweating through the duvet at 03:30; then the rain and wildlife kicked in. I decided to leave at 05:30AM, and travel the nearly 550 miles home. Needless to say, I will not be staying there again. Visitors pay decent money to proprietors who expect their visitors to put up with conditions they would not do themselves when they stay away from home. Quite annoyed to be honest.
